Position Overview:



We are seeking a reliable and skilled Maintenance Person to join our team at Graceland Nursing Home. The successful candidate will be responsible for supporting our Full Time Mainstenance Staff in maintaining the care home's building, equipment, furniture, and external areas to ensure a safe, clean, and functional environment for residents, staff, and visitors. This role requires a proactive individual with practical maintenance experience and basic skills in areas such as joinery, plumbing, and electrical work. Additionally, the role involves driving the care home's minibus for resident appointments and outings.

Key Responsibilities:



Building Maintenance & Repairs:



Perform routine maintenance and basic repairs on the building, furniture, and equipment. Identify and address potential maintenance issues promptly to prevent larger problems. Maintain accurate, legible maintenance schedules and records.

Liaison with External Tradespersons:



Coordinate and liaise with external tradespersons visiting the site to carry out specialised maintenance or repairs. Monitor and ensure the quality of work performed by external contractors. Assist in the implementation of maintenance policies and procedures.

Health & Safety:



Assist with periodic health and safety checks, including testing of equipment, fire safety systems, and emergency lighting. Ensure compliance with health and safety regulations within the care home. Take reasonable care of the health and safety of themselves and all other persons who may be affected by their acts or omissions at work.

External Area Maintenance:



Maintain external areas, including gardens, pathways, and car parks, ensuring they are clean, safe, and well-presented. Conduct seasonal tasks such as salting pathways in winter and general garden upkeep. Perform snow removal and other ground duties as required.

Minibus Operation:



Drive the care home's minibus to transport residents to appointments, activities, and outings. Ensure the minibus is clean, safe, and maintained in good working order. Maintain accurate records of vehicle maintenance and usage.

General Duties:



Maintain a schedule of planned and reactive maintenance tasks. Respond to urgent maintenance requests promptly and effectively. Maintain accurate records of maintenance activities and liaise with the Care Home Manager regarding ongoing needs. Assist in the collation of performance indicator data/evidence where necessary.
